Steve Moffat said... 

Well then in your position, I would throw away my dest sets and start your
own. There is quite a bit of work involved to find out what sites are hosted
where, e.g bobsshop.com may be hosted on an akamai server somewhere and that
site is harmless, but thisbighorseandmygirfriend.com may also be hosted on
the same akamai server and obviously you would blacklist this site, which
means that you wouldn't get to bobsshop.com either. ASs Jim said, unless you
want ISA to use the rules strictly as written then you have to add the
SkipNameResolution... registry entries spelled out in
 <http://support.microsoft.com/default.aspx?scid=292018>
http://support.microsoft.com/default.aspx?scid=292018
